Installation

Carefully unpack the inverter and inspect for any damage. Install the inverter in a well-ventilated area.

  1. Mount the inverter on a stable surface or wall.
  2. Connect the DC input from the solar panels or battery.
  3. Connect the AC output to the electrical system.
  4. Ensure all connections are secure before powering on.

WARNING! Ensure proper ventilation to avoid overheating. Follow local electrical codes during installation.

First-Time Setup

Power on the inverter and follow the on-screen prompts to configure settings.

  1. Select the operating mode: Grid-tied or Off-grid.
  2. Set the output voltage and frequency as per local standards.
  3. Configure any additional settings via the LCD menu.

CAUTION! Ensure all settings are correct before operation.

Connecting Devices

Ensure the inverter is powered off before making any connections.

  1. Connect solar panels or battery to the DC input terminals.
  2. Connect the AC output to the electrical system or load.
  3. Check all connections for tightness and correctness.

Tip: Use appropriate gauge wiring for connections to prevent overheating.

Troubleshooting

SymptomPossible CauseCorrective Action
No outputPower source issueCheck DC input connections and power source.
Error code displayedFault conditionRefer to the manual for error code definitions and solutions.
OverheatingPoor ventilationEnsure adequate airflow around the inverter.
Low efficiencyIncorrect settingsVerify settings and adjust as necessary.
